WebRight-click on the report object that you wish to hide if no data is found. In this example, we are going to hide the text box called ContactName. When the Properties window appears, set the "Can Shrink" property to "Yes. By setting the "Can Shrink" property to "Yes, the Contact Name will not print a blank line if it has no value.
WebJun 16, 2016 · If there is a label control to the left of the text box, it won't shrink. If this is the case then I would change the label control to a text box and set the control source to something like: =IIf (IsNull ( [YourMemoFieldName]),Null,"Label Caption Value") Then set this text box to Can Shrink. WebJan 21, 2024 · The CanGrow property uses the following settings. The section or control grows vertically so that all data it contains can be printed or previewed. (Default) The section or control doesn't grow. Data that doesn't fit within the fixed size of the section or control won't be printed or previewed.
